Biden Administration Executive Order seeks to Promote Competition by Limiting Non-Compete Agreements
On July 9, 2021 President Biden signed the Executive Order on Promoting Competition in the American Economy. The Order directs the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) to consider enacting rules to ban or limit non-compete agreements. The scope is unclear as the Order calls for the FTC to curtail "unfair use" of non-compete clauses. The Order also addresses other clauses that may restrict employee movement such as employee and customer non-solicitation agreements. See National Law Review, JDSupra.
